Two children died in a house fire which police believe was started when a can of hairspray left on a mantlepiece above a fire exploded. Sasha Finney, six, and her brother Adrian, three, were overcome by smoke at the house in Devizes, Wiltshire. A 14-year-old babysitter tried to save the children from the upstairs bedroom but was beaten back by smoke.
